One solution to replace your LCD is to buy a defective camera online and use the LCD to fix your camera. You can also try contacting the manufacturer and see if they sell the LCD, I don't know what camera you have so I can't tell you if they do or not.
Another solution is to have it fixed by a real digital camera repair business and not some place like the 'G**k Sq**d' as all they will do is send it to the manufacturer and charge you $150.
